AN URUGUAYAN AIRMAN DISAPPEARS ON TRANS-ATLANTIC FLIGHT. Received March 4, 11.30 p.m. MADRID, March 4. The Uruguayan aviator, Major Borges, left Casablanch for Las Palmas, a flight of 600 miles, early on Wednesday. There has been no news of him since. Four wireless stations all night sent out calls to pick him up, but received no response. It is possible that he came down on a lonely part of the coast, with his wireless broken down. A French cruiser is searching and Spanish airmen at present in Morocco have offered to search the ocean. Major Borges is accompanied in the seaplane by his brother, a wireless operator, a spare pilot and a mechanic.
